If you consider section order as priority, then you already have it: when you
insert a section in the middle, all the ones below are of lower priority,
without you having to change anything else.
Use M-up and M-down to reorder sections.
You can use the sorting order only when you have many [#A] or [#B] or [#C] of
the same type together.
You could also use [#A] [#B] [#C] [#D] [#E], but I think 3 groups is enough.
